As cyberattacks via email continue to surge each year, safeguarding your business with robust email security measures is more critical than ever. In today’s fast-paced digital world, cybercriminals constantly refine their tactics, exploiting vulnerabilities that many organisations may not even be aware of. Small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s) are particularly vulnerable, often seen as easy targets due to potentially weaker security infrastructures. These enterprises may lack the necessary resources or expertise to deploy comprehensive cybersecurity protocols, making them prime targets for attackers.
Email remains a primary vector for these attacks, serving as a conduit for phishing scams, malware dissemination, and unauthorised access to sensitive information. Cybercriminals employ cunning strategies, such as impersonating trusted contacts or crafting seemingly legitimate requests, to deceive employees into revealing confidential data or clicking on malicious links.
The fallout from a successful email-based attack can be catastrophic. Beyond immediate financial losses, businesses risk enduring reputational damage, erosion of customer trust, and potential legal consequences if sensitive data is compromised. To bolster your business’s defences against these threats, consider implementing a comprehensive email security strategy that encompasses the following:
- Employee Training and Awareness: Empower your team by educating them about the latest phishing techniques and fostering a culture of vigilance when handling emails. Regular training sessions can help employees identify suspicious emails and emphasise the importance of avoiding unknown links or attachments.
- Advanced Email Filtering Systems: Deploy cutting-edge filtering solutions capable of detecting and blocking spam and malicious emails before they reach your employees' inboxes. These systems leverage machine learning algorithms to identify patterns associated with phishing attempts and other fraudulent activities.
-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A): Strengthen your defences by implementing MFA for accessing business email accounts. This adds an extra layer of security by requiring users to provide multiple verification factors before gaining access.
- Regular Security Audits: Conduct frequent audits of your email security systems to uncover potential vulnerabilities and ensure alignment with industry standards. This proactive approach can help mitigate risks before they escalate into significant threats.
- Incident Response Plan: Establish a robust incident response plan detailing the steps your organisation will take in the event of a cyber-attack. This plan should encompass communication strategies, roles and responsibilities, and recovery procedures to minimise damage and swiftly restore normal operations.
